Abstract: ,In the present dissertation, a discrete event simulation package "DESIPAC" has been developed for Turbo C in Turbo C on IBM PC/XT(AT) compatible. DESIPAC is a collection of procedures that allow discrete event simulation programs to be easily developed in 'C'. The package supports basic data structures (FACILITY,STORAGE,CHAIN and TRANSACTION) to define entities and provides procedures for creating and managing these entities and for displaying output of the simulation. CSMA/CD protocol for Local Area Network and a teleprocessing system have been simu-lated using DESIPAC.
